Charges of Assault, Stealing Are Filed

May 24, 2011 | Law Enforcement, Sheriff's Office

Two persons arrested recently were scheduled to make their initial court appearances today.

According to the Grundy County Sheriff’s Department, 25-year-old Jennifer Koenig of Trenton has been arrested for third degree domestic assault. She is accused of causing physical injury to Laci Dunn, a family member, by punching her in the face several times. She is being held in the Grundy County Detention Center on $2,500 cash or corporate surety bond.
Also arrested was Jason Lovett, a 36-year-old resident of Auxvasse. He is charged with stealing (third offense), a class D felony. Lovett is accused of appropriating condoms and a plier set from Pamida and has two prior stealing-related convictions. He is being held in the Grundy County Detention Center on $5,000 cash or corporate surety bond.
